What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

A urine drug screening test is an analytical process that examines a urine sample to identify the presence of drugs and their breakdown elements, known as metabolites. This method is predominantly favored in employment environments and regulatory frameworks, especially in Shackelford, CA, due to its non-intrusive nature, cost-efficiency, and ability to identify a wide array of substances over a relevant timeframe.

  • Specimens are collected following rigorous chain-of-custody protocols, ensuring the integrity of regulated testing procedures.
  • This process can detect both the original drugs and their metabolites as they are eliminated from the body via urine.
  • It highlights previous drug exposure within a specified detection period, but it does not measure current impairment levels.

How It Works

Collection

  • Within Shackelford, CA, the donor furnishes a sample in a secure container, with options for both observed and unobserved collection according to program guidelines.
  • Specimen validity evaluations may encompass assessments of cre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H balance.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• The initial screening involves an immunoassay, offering a swift and efficient assessment of drug presence.
  • Presumptive positives undergo verification through advanced methods like g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C/MS) or li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ectrometry (LC/MS/MS).
  • Determining positive or negative test outcomes involves comparing observed concentrations against established cutoff levels measured in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L).

Detection Windows

Drug detection periods fluctuate based on variables like substance type, consumption frequency, individual metabolic rates, hydration levels, body composition, and test sensitivity. Detection ranges from 1-3 days for many drugs to potentially longer periods for substances like cannabinoids in habitual users.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In Shackelford, CA, hair drug analysis involves examining a small segment of hair to reveal drug presence along with their metabolites, which have circulated in the bloodstream and been embedded in the hair shaft. Given hair's slow growth and its capacity to store drug residues over time, it offers one of the longest detection windows available, making it particularly useful in identifying habitual or prolonged substance use.

  • This typically involves cutting 100–120 strands near the scalp, spanning about 1.5 inches.
  • This sample generally covers approximately a 90-day detection span, adjusted by hair length.
  • It is capable of detecting a vast array of substances, including am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Shackelford, CA, at the collection point, a small sample, generally from the crown area, is trimmed in compliance with chain-of-custody regulations.
  • The sample is then carefully sealed, labeled, and dispatched to a certified laboratory for analysis.
  • In cases where scalp hair is unavailable, alternate sites such as body hair may be utilized.

Testing Methodology

  • In Shackelford, CA, hair samples undergo washing and preparation procedures to eliminate any external contamination.
  • Initial screenings employ immunoassay technology for macro detection across drug classes.
  • Screens registering positive undergo further testing using GC/MS or LC/MS/MS for precise validation.
  • Cutoff levels, determined in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), align with SAMHSA and lab stand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: No drug or metabolite surpasses the established laboratory cutoff level.
  • Positive: Presence of a drug or metabolite confirmed via secondary testing methodologies.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Instances of inadequate sample size or contamination necessitating recollection.

Detection Windows

Hair testing, used in Shackelford, CA, provides the broadest detection window among drug testing methods. A typical 1.5-inch hair sample can depict up to 90 days of potential drug activity. Greater hair lengths might expand this testing window further, contingent on growth rates (roughly half an inch a month). Unlike urine or oral fluid assays, hair analysis does not catch very recent usage (within 7–10 days).
